Please give an example when you have worked well as part of a team?
0
votes
I would like someone to give me an example, out of his own personal experience, on how he was more productive when he was working with a team, and how the presence of a team charter positively affected his productivity and his integration within the team.

Are you talking about me as a project manager or me as a developer? Because you can be part of the team and, of course, a team player even if you are a project manager.
In any case, I remember several years ago, when I was a developer, we were working under this great project manager: conflicts were only a few and were solved on the spot, team motivation was really high, and we were finishing things fast. I think it all had to do with how the project manager managed the project, he didn't micromanage yet he didn't leave us by ourselves, he was there to help, and he was always monitoring things in the background.
I remember back then we had a team charter (see an example of a team charter here:
http://www.projectmanagementquestions.com/2216/give-me-an-example-of-a-team-charter
) and it helped us a lot in knowing our roles and responsibilities on the project. The team charter was also very handy because it defined how communication worked between us (the team members).
I think I gave more than 100% of my energy on this project, and I was always motivated, and so were all the other team members.
